New Gwadar International Airport to be Inaugurated on March 23

Federal Minister for Planning, Development and Special Initiatives Ahsan Iqbal announced on Saturday that New Gwadar International Airport would begin operations on March 23 next year.

This happened during a meeting to finalize the tariff model for airports in Balochistan to increase traffic and improve air connections for the provinces.

The Minister for Planning directed the authorities to ensure that the inauguration and conversion of operations from the old Gwadar airport to the new Gwadar airport take place in March next year. “It will be a gift to the people of Balochistan on Pakistan Day,” he added.

The minister also announced plans to expand international flight operations from Quetta Airport by August 14 to improve Balochistan’s links with the Middle East. During the meeting, it was reported that PIA operates 30 weekly flights to three cities in Balochistan.

Present were Maritime Affairs Advisor Jawad Khokhar, Additional Secretary for Planning Dawood Muhammad, Secretary for Aviation, Chief Secretary of Balochistan, CEO of Pakistan International Airlines and Deputy Director-General of the Civil Aviation Authority.

It is worth mentioning that the airport is one of the main projects of the China-Pakistan Economic Corridor (CPEC).
